ExxonMobil Senior QA Salaries in Fort Worth, TX

The average ExxonMobil Senior QA in Fort Worth, TX earns an estimated $86,149 annually. ExxonMobil's Senior QA compensation is $23,638 less than the US average for a Senior QA.

In Fort Worth, TX, The Engineering Department at ExxonMobil earns $9,029 more on average than the IT Department.

Senior QA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Senior QA at companies similar size to ExxonMobil reported making $112,555, while the average male Senior QA at similar sized companies reported making $113,137.

Senior QA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Senior QA at companies similar size to ExxonMobil reported making $115,385, while the average African American/Black Senior QA at similar sized companies reported making $93,333.
